Formal and informal assessments help counselors more accurately assess client issues, create case conceptualizations, select effective empirically proven therapies, and evaluate ongoing progress (Whiston, 2008). Differential psychology, the study of the nature and extent of individual and group variability, and of the factors that determine or affect these differences, is one of two formative progenitors of counseling psychology.
